Introduce o3tl::sprintf
...in preparation for follow-up commits that will replace many uses of std::sprintf (which started to emit deprecation warnings with macOS 13 SDK now) across the code base with various alternatives Change-Id: I9602f1cb0e28d1b70c2356edb52d78dd165f1118 Reviewed-on: https://gerrit.libreoffice.org/c/core/+/142317 Tested-by: Jenkins Reviewed-by: Stephan Bergmann <sbergman@redhat.com>

namespace o3tl
|
||||
{
|
||||
// A drop-in replacement for safe uses of std::sprintf where it is statically known that the
|
||||
// provided buffer is large enough. Compared to a plain use of std::sprintf, using o3tl::sprintf
|
||||
// for one makes it explicit that the call is considerd safe and for another avoids deprecation
|
||||
// warnings on platforms like the macOS 13 SDK that mark std::sprintf as deprecated. Many simple
|
||||
// uses of std::sprintf across the code base can be replaced with alternative code using e.g.
|
||||
// OString::number. This is for the remaining formatting-rich cases for which there is no easy
|
||||
// replacement yet in our C++17 baseline. Ultimately, it should be removed again once alternatives
|
||||
// for those remaining cases, like C++20 std::format, are available.
|
||||
template <std::size_t N, typename... T>
|
||||
int sprintf(char (&s)[N], char const* format, T&&... arguments)
|
||||
{
|
||||
auto const n = std::snprintf(s, N, format, std::forward<T>(arguments)...);
|
||||
assert(n < 0 || o3tl::make_unsigned(n) < N);
|
||||
(void)n;
|
||||
return n;
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
